site stats

Terraform aws s3 bucket object

Web5 Jan 2024 · You need to deliver the AWS Config information to an S3 bucket, which can also be created automatically when you are signing up for the AWS Config service in the console. You can optionally... Webs3_bucket_policy_changes: If you want to create alarm when any changes in S3 policy. bool: true: no: s3_bucket_public_write_prohibited: Checks that your S3 buckets do not allow public write access. bool: false: no: s3_bucket_ssl_requests_only: Checks whether S3 buckets have policies that require requests to use Secure Socket Layer (SSL). bool ...

aws_s3_bucket_objects Data Sources - registry.terraform.io

WebRegistry . Please enable Javascript to use this application Web12 Apr 2024 · 1 Answer. A public bucket does not imply that all objects within it are also public. The permissions are more fine-grained than that. To allow blanket access to every object within the bucket by anyone at all, you can use the aws_s3_bucket_policy resource to give the s3:GetObject permission to everyone. david seiffert genetic counselor https://unrefinedsolutions.com

How to upload files to S3 with Terraform - bacdam.dev

Web2 days ago · タイトルにある通り、Terraformを使ってAWS側で必要なサービスを作成します。 解説もコード内のコメントにある程度は記載しています。 特にLambda@Edgeを … WebAWS Region. string: n/a: yes: s3_object_ownership: Specifies the S3 object ownership control on the origin bucket. Valid values are ObjectWriter, BucketOwnerPreferred, and … WebExtensively used Terraform in AWS Virtual Private Cloud to automatically setup and modify settings by interfacing with control layer. Experience in building private cloud infrastructure of OpenStack, deploying through puppet and maintaining them in production. david seiler plastics

amazon web services - Fail safe reading s3_bucket_object with …

Category:AWS/DevOps Engineer Resume Ashburn, VA - Hire IT People

Tags:Terraform aws s3 bucket object

Terraform aws s3 bucket object

interrupt-software/terraform-aws-s3-bucket-cp - GitHub

Webterraform-aws-s3-bucket . This module creates an S3 bucket with support for versioning, lifecycles, object locks, replication, encryption, ACL, bucket object policies, and static website hosting. Web13 May 2024 · With that extra argument in place, Terraform will detect when the MD5 hash of the file on disk is different than that stored remotely in S3 and will plan to update the …

Terraform aws s3 bucket object

Did you know?

WebApply changes to an AWS S3 bucket and bucket objects using resource targeting. Target individual resources, modules, and collections of resources to change or destroy. Explore how Terraform handles upstream and downstream dependencies. ... Terraform updated the selected bucket objects and notified you that the changes to your infrastructure may ... WebRegistry . Please enable Javascript to use this application

WebHere are some additional notes for the above-mentioned Terraform file – for_each = fileset(“uploads/”, “*”) – For loop for iterating over the files located under upload directory. … Web10 Apr 2024 · Amazon S3 enforces two security best practices and brings new visibility into object replication status – As announced on December 13, 2024, Amazon S3 is now deploying two new default bucket security settings by automatically enabling S3 Block Public Access and disabling S3 access control lists (ACLs) for all new S3 buckets. …

WebHere are some additional notes for the above-mentioned Terraform file – for_each = fileset(“uploads/”, “*”) – For loop for iterating over the files located under upload directory. bucket = aws_s3_bucket.spacelift-test1-s3.id – The original S3 bucket ID which we created in Step 2. Key = each.value – You have to assign a key for the name of the object, once it’s … WebWhen you configure your bucket to use S3 Bucket Keys for SSE-KMS on new objects, AWS KMS generates a bucket-level key that is used to create a unique data key for objects in the bucket. This S3 Bucket Key is used for a time-limited period within Amazon S3, reducing the need for Amazon S3 to make requests to AWS KMS to complete encryption ...

WebEvery Terraform open source provisioned product has a single-state file. There is a 1:1 relationship between the provisioned product and its state file. The files are stored in an Amazon S3 bucket named sc-terraform-engine-state-$ { AWS::AccountId}-$ { AWS::Region}. The state file is saved under the AccountID or ProvisionedProductID object key.

Webterraform apply -auto-approve -var= "bucket_name=my_bucket" However, the first problem still persists with this method. My current solution The aws_s3_object resource After consulting my good friend, Google, I found out that there is a Terraform resource called, aws_s3_object which I can use to upload local david seidner chiropractorWeb23 Jul 2024 · The first two fields s3_bucket and s3_key is the lambda deploy bucket and s3 key object. Terraform will instruct AWS to create lambda code from s3 object. Terraform will instruct AWS to create ... david seidman opthamologistWebAWS S3 bucket Terraform module Usage. Conditional creation. Sometimes you need to have a way to create S3 resources conditionally but Terraform does not allow... … david segal segal family investments